Is Tinactin an Approved HSA Expense?

Many people wonder if over-the-counter medications like Tinactin are approved HSA expenses.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) offer a way to save for eligible medical expenses with tax-free funds. When it comes to what you can purchase with your HSA funds, it's essential to understand the guidelines set by the IRS.

Tinactin is an antifungal medication commonly used to treat athlete's foot, jock itch, and other fungal infections. As an over-the-counter product, Tinactin is typically eligible for purchase using your HSA funds. However, there are a few things to consider:

  • Make sure Tinactin is being used to treat a specific medical condition and is not purely for cosmetic purposes.
  • Keep the receipt for your Tinactin purchase for documentation purposes.
  • Consult with your healthcare provider to ensure Tinactin is the right treatment for your condition.

While Tinactin is generally an approved HSA expense, it's always a good idea to double-check with your HSA provider or refer to the IRS guidelines for a comprehensive list of eligible expenses. Remember, using your HSA funds for non-qualified expenses may result in tax penalties.
